Key Elements of an Effective Breaking News Logo

So, what makes a live breaking news logo PNG really pop and do its job effectively? It's not just about looking cool, although that helps! There are several key design principles that make these graphics work. Firstly, simplicity is king. Think about logos like CNN's or BBC's. They're not overly complex. They use clean lines, straightforward fonts, and easily recognizable shapes. This simplicity ensures they are legible even at small sizes or when viewed quickly on a fast-moving news ticker. Secondly, boldness. Breaking news often implies drama and importance, so the logo needs to have a strong visual presence. This usually translates to using bold colors, often reds, blacks, or stark whites, and thick, impactful typography. The color choice is critical; red, for instance, is universally associated with urgency and danger, making it a go-to for breaking news alerts. Thirdly, dynamism. While a static logo is fine, many breaking news graphics incorporate subtle animations or design elements that suggest movement, speed, or immediacy. This could be a blinking effect, a swooshing line, or a pulsating graphic. These elements, even if small, contribute to the feeling that something is happening now. Fourth, legibility. The text within the logo, if any, must be incredibly easy to read. News requires quick comprehension, and a logo filled with tiny, fancy script is a recipe for disaster. Sans-serif fonts are generally preferred for their clarity and modern feel. Finally, versatility. A great live breaking news logo PNG needs to work across various platforms and contexts. It should look good on a dark background, a light background, in a small icon, or as a full-screen graphic. The PNG format's transparency is a massive advantage here, allowing for seamless integration into diverse media. When you're searching for or designing your breaking news logo, keep these elements in mind. Ask yourself: Is it simple? Is it bold? Does it feel dynamic? Is it easy to read? And can it be used everywhere? By focusing on these core principles, you'll be well on your way to finding or creating a logo that truly captures the essence of live, breaking news and resonates with your audience.

Where to Find Top-Notch Live Breaking News Logo PNGs

Alright, you're convinced you need a killer live breaking news logo PNG, but where do you actually find these gems? Don't worry, guys, the internet is brimming with options! One of the best places to start is on stock photo and vector sites. Platforms like Adobe Stock, Shutterstock, Getty Images, and even free resources like Pexels or Unsplash (though you might need to search a bit harder for specific news graphics there) offer a vast array of professional logo designs. You'll likely need to use specific search terms like "breaking news graphic," "news alert icon," "urgent broadcast logo," or "journalism symbol" to narrow down the results. Many of these sites offer high-resolution PNG files, often with transparent backgrounds, perfect for immediate use. Graphic design marketplaces are another fantastic avenue. Websites like Envato Elements, Creative Market, or GraphicRiver have designers uploading new logos and graphic elements daily. You can often find unique, stylized breaking news logos here that aren't as widely used as those on larger stock sites. Some offer subscription models, giving you access to a huge library for a monthly fee, which can be incredibly cost-effective if you need a lot of graphics. Don't forget about freelance graphic designers. If you have a specific vision or need something completely custom, hiring a freelancer on platforms like Upwork, Fiverr, or 99designs is an excellent option. You can collaborate directly with a designer to create a logo that perfectly matches your brand identity and the tone of your news coverage. While this might be more expensive than buying a stock logo, the result will be unique and tailored specifically to you. Finally, consider specialized news graphic providers. Some companies focus specifically on creating broadcast graphics packages, which often include breaking news logos. A quick search for "broadcast graphics packages" or "news intro templates" might lead you to these specialized resources. Remember to always check the licensing terms for any graphic you download, especially if you plan to use it commercially. Ensure the license covers your intended use case. By exploring these different avenues, you're sure to find a live breaking news logo PNG that fits your budget, your style, and your urgent need for impactful visual communication. Happy hunting!

Common Pitfalls to Avoid

Even with the best intentions, there are a few common traps people fall into when using live breaking news logo PNG files. Let’s make sure you guys dodge these bullets! First off, using low-resolution images. We touched on this, but it bears repeating. A blurry, pixelated logo just looks bad. Always, always ensure you're using a high-resolution file. If you download a PNG and it looks fuzzy when you zoom in, it's probably not going to look good on screen. Stick to vectors or high-res PNGs. Secondly, ignoring transparency. Remember why we love PNGs? Transparency! If your logo comes with a big, white, or colored box around it, it's going to look unprofessional when you try to overlay it on video or other graphics. Make sure your PNG file has a transparent background so it blends seamlessly. Thirdly, inconsistent branding. Using different versions of your logo, or not using it at all on certain platforms, dilutes your brand's strength. Stick to one primary live breaking news logo PNG and use it everywhere – website, social media, video intros, watermarks, you name it. Fourth, overusing or misplacing the logo. While branding is important, don't clutter your content. A logo that's too large, flashes too erratically, or is placed in a distracting position can annoy viewers and detract from the news itself. Find that sweet spot between visibility and subtlety. Fifth, copyright and licensing issues. Don't just grab any logo you find on Google Images! You could be infringing on someone's copyright. Always source your logos from reputable stock sites, marketplaces, or from a designer who has explicitly granted you usage rights. Read the license agreements carefully. Lastly, failing to update. If your logo looks dated or your brand has evolved, it's time for a refresh. A stale logo can make your news outlet seem out of touch. Keep your visual identity modern and relevant. By being mindful of these common pitfalls, you can ensure that your live breaking news logo PNG is a powerful asset that enhances your credibility and reach, rather than becoming a hindrance.
